The article "Development of emotional intelligence in 4-year-old children: benefits and innovative practices" explores the importance of the development of emotional intelligence in preschool children. The objective was to promote emotional intelligence in 4-year-old children through innovative practices. As methodology, descriptive quantitative research was used. The sample was represented by 20 children from Los Pinos-Intisana preschool, who participated in practices such as: play activities, role-playing, storytelling and relaxation techniques. As a result, the improvement of social skills, emotional self-regulation and school performance was evidenced. To conclude, the emotional development of the children was achieved thanks to the support of the educators and parents, who played a crucial role through a comprehensive approach that encompassed both cognitive and emotional aspects to favor the children's integral development.
